Lewis M. Cook is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Geophysics and Nuclear and High Energy Physics. According to data from OpenAlex, Lewis M. Cook has authored 27 papers receiving a total of 512 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 26 papers in Astronomy and Astrophysics, 6 papers in Geophysics and 4 papers in Nuclear and High Energy Physics. Recurrent topics in Lewis M. Cook’s work include Astrophysical Phenomena and Observations (23 papers), Gamma-ray bursts and supernovae (15 papers) and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(8 papers). Lewis M. Cook is often cited by papers focused on Astrophysical Phenomena and Observations (23 papers), Gamma-ray bursts and supernovae (15 papers) and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(8 papers). Lewis M. Cook collaborates with scholars based in United States, Japan and Ukraine. Lewis M. Cook's co-authors include David R. Skillman, J. Patterson, Robert Fried, Tonny Vanmunster, Lasse Jensen, Robert Rea, Jonathan Kemp, N. Butterworth, Gianluca Masi and Berto Monard and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, The Astrophysical Journal and Astronomy and Astrophysics.
